Burbank, CA – On the eve of his TOP 10 debut of “SUPERBAD – THE RETURN OF BOOSIE BAD AZZ,” Trill Entertainment/Asylum Records recording artist, LIL BOOSIE has agreed to a 2-year prison term for possession of marijuana.  Boosie heads back to court on November 9, 2009 to receive his sentencing and is expected to spend a year in jail according to the Good Time allowance that the Department of Corrections grants.
 
“I am looking forward to putting this all behind me and would like to thank my fans and industry fam for their continued support of me and SuperBad,” states Boosie.  “I need y’all to know that I am still recording and working on a new record that will come out Fall 2010 and I plan to be home in time to promote it.  I am also in the studio working on a new mix tape with Young Jeezy and set to release the movie, “Ghetto Stories: The Movie” by the end of the year.  Y’all ain’t 'gon miss me. Believe that."
 
Boosie has taken the music industry by storm when his long awaited sophomore album “SUPERBAD – THE RETURN OF BOOSIE BAD AZZ” cracked the Billboard 200 Top 10 (#7) its first week on the charts and reached #5 on the R&B/Hip-Hop Albums chart and #4 on the Top Rap Albums chart.
 
“SUPERBAD – THE RETURN OF BOOSIE BAD AZZ’S” chart position on the Billboard 200 places the Louisiana native in some distinguished company of platinum and multi-platinum artist such as Jay-Z, Whitney Houston, Raekwon and Brooks and Dunn.
 
The CD is the follow up to the Baton Rouge native’s 2006 gold-selling, critically acclaimed debut, “Bad Azz.”  The CD is produced by The Runners, Mouse on the Track, Guss, B Real, Big Wayne, BJ, Maniac, Nard & B and offers guest appearances from Young Jeezy, Trina, Bobby V along with Trill Entertainment’s own Webbie, Fox, Lil Trill, Lil’ Phat and Mouse.
 
“You Better Believe It,” the Mouse-produced lead single featuring Young Jeezy and label mate Webbie, is up 113% in spins from last week. In addition, three (3) viral videos -- "Top Notch," "I'm A Dog," and the second single "Loose As A Goose" produced by B Real -- have been released to the internet.
